New York Edison Company was an early electric utility that played a central role in electrifying Manhattan, Brooklyn, and parts of Queens during the late 19th and early 20th centuries. Founded amid technological competitions between companies such as Edison Illuminating Company and Westinghouse Electric, it operated generating stations, distribution networks, and retail metering during periods of rapid urban growth and infrastructure modernization that involved figures tied to Thomas Edison, J.P. Morgan, and the General Electric Company (1892) consolidation. Its activities intersected with municipal efforts in New York City, state regulation in New York (state), and broader utility reorganizations culminating in affiliations with holding companies and trusts involved in the Public Utility Holding Company Act of 1935 era.
